Overview

Hugh Cutting made history in 2021 as the first countertenor to win the coveted Kathleen Ferrier Award and join the roster of BBC New Generation Artists. Hailed by The Times as owner of ‘an exceptional voice: lustrous and rounded, with power in reserve and immaculate intonation’, his emergence as a rising-star soloist rests on adamantine foundations.
